**09:40** — Support started getting tickets that Reportsmith tables were "shuffling" rows with equal values between refreshes. Turns out the new sort routine wasn't stable, so ties landed in arbitrary order each run. Nothing was lost — it just looked flaky to customers. We swapped back to the stable sort at 11:05 and re-rendered cached reports. You can tell customers it's fixed as of the build noted below.

trace token, fafog-kageg: htk4_98e6

## Releases

Hey support folks — quick notes on ProfileMesh shard releases. Each release re-balances user-profile shards gradually, so don't panic if a lookup lands on a stale shard for a few minutes post-deploy; it self-heals. Release bundles are published twice a month and are always signed. If a customer asks you to verify a bundle they downloaded, walk them through the checksum step using the public signing key below.

deploy key for kawif-bageg: bky19_YQNdHDgpaLxUNwPoHm9

## Flagwright Rollout Runbook — Stage 2

Welcome aboard. Every flag rollout at Perrow Systems goes through Flagwright's staged ramp: 1%, 10%, 50%, then full. Between stages, check the guardrail dashboard for error-rate and latency regressions, and wait at least 20 minutes. Never skip a stage, even for trivial flags — the framework logs each transition for audit. Once all checks pass, publish the rollout manifest, which must be signed with the key that follows.

signing key of bagap-yawep = bky13_TbfT6ZMUoGJo2